    Abstract: A clothing dryer including a water level sensing device capable of detecting a water level of condensed water, using a simple structure. The clothing dryer includes a body, a drum rotatably installed in the body, the drum receiving objects to be dried, a base arranged beneath the body, a dehumidifying unit mounted to the base, to condense moisture contained in air discharged from the drum, a water container to collect condensed water formed in the dehumidifying unit, and a water level sensing device to detect a level of the condensed water collected in the water container. The water level sensing device includes a floating unit movable in accordance with a variation in the level of the condensed water. The water level sensing device also includes an electrode sensor to detect the level of the condensed water when electrically connected with the conductor of the floating unit.

    Abstract: A method for manufacturing a semiconductor light emitting device is provided. The method includes forming a light emitting structure by sequentially growing a first conductivity-type semiconductor layer, an active layer, and a second conductivity-type semiconductor layer on a semiconductor growth substrate A support unit is disposed on the second conductivity-type semiconductor layer, so as to be combined with the light emitting structure. The semiconductor growth substrate is separated from the light emitting structure. An interface between the semiconductor growth substrate and a remaining light emitting structure is wet-etched such that the light emitting structure remaining on the separated semiconductor growth substrate is separated therefrom. The semiconductor growth substrate is cleaned.

    Abstract: A clothing dryer having an improved structure of a drainage unit thereof, including: a body; a drum; a base that is disposed at a lower portion of the drum; a first water tub that is mounted on the base to collect condensate water generated when a drying operation is performed; and a plurality of drainage pipes that are combined with one side of the first water tub and cause the condensate water to move, wherein, in order to change a position at which the plurality of drainage pipes and the first water tub are combined with each other, the first water tub is combined with edges of the base so that at least a part of the first water tub is able to be exposed to an outside.
